The Ncma Cathode Materia And Ncma Quaternary Precursor Market reached a valuation of 6.2 billion in 2025 and is anticipated to expand at a CAGR of 7.21% during the forecast period from 2026 to 2033, ultimately attaining an estimated value of 10.83 billion by 2033. Global NCMA Cathode Material And NCMA Quaternary Precursor Market Analysis

The global market for NCMA (Nickel-Cobalt-Manganese-Aluminum) cathode materials and NCMA quaternary precursors is experiencing significant growth driven by the rising demand for high-performance batteries, particularly in electric vehicles and renewable energy storage systems. Advancements in material composition and manufacturing processes are further propelling market expansion, supported by increasing investments from industry leaders and government initiatives aimed at sustainable energy solutions.
